Ye Guangkuan, a villager in Lijiakou Village, Liujie Township, Yongqing County, Hebei Province, who has planted crops for half his life, stopped planting winter wheat in response to the national seasonal fallow policy in 2019. The average yield of corn per mu increased by about 50 kilograms the following year. , plus a fallow subsidy of 500 yuan per mu, the annual average net income per mu is about 600 yuan, which is about 200 yuan higher than before fallow.

  Hebei is a typical resource-based and water-scarce province. The groundwater has been overexploited for a long time, forming the largest groundwater funnel area in the country.

As a large agricultural province, Hebei's wheat planting area is about 33 million mu, and agricultural water accounts for more than half of the total economic and social water use.

After the implementation of one season (wheat) fallow and one season (corn) planting, the average water consumption per mu is reduced by 150 cubic meters.

At present, 2 million mu of arable land in Hebei Province is seasonally fallow, reducing the exploitation of groundwater by 300 million cubic meters a year.

  Exploring and implementing the pilot system of cultivated land rotation and fallow in some areas is a major decision-making arrangement made by the Party Central Committee and the State Council in view of the prominent contradictions in my country's agricultural development and the changes in supply and demand in the domestic and foreign grain markets. The purpose is to promote cultivated land recuperation and sustainable agricultural development.

  In November 2015, General Secretary Xi Jinping pointed out in the "Explanation on the Proposals of the Central Committee of the Communist Party of China on Formulating the Thirteenth Five-Year Plan for National Economic and Social Development": "To implement the system of crop rotation and fallow, the country can Supply and demand situation, focus on carrying out pilot projects in groundwater funnel areas, heavy metal pollution areas, and areas with severe ecological degradation, arrange a certain area of ​​cultivated land for fallow, and provide necessary grain or cash subsidies to fallow farmers.”

  In June 2016, the former Ministry of Agriculture and the Ministry of Finance jointly issued the "Pilot Plan for Exploring and Implementing the Land Rotation and Fallow Land System", proposing that "adhere to ecological priority, comprehensive management, rotation as the mainstay and fallow as a supplement, in order to ensure national food security and not affect the Farmers’ income is the premise”, and took the lead in carrying out crop rotation pilots in the cold and cool areas of the northeast and the interlaced areas of agriculture and animal husbandry in the north, and carried out pilots of fallow in the groundwater funnel area of ​​Hebei, the heavy metal pollution area of ​​Hunan, and the severely degraded ecological areas of the southwest and northwest.

Since the pilot program, the area of ​​crop rotation fallow has increased from 6.16 million mu in 2016 to 69.26 million mu in 2022, and the number of provinces implementing it has increased from 9 to 24.

  Since 2016, my country has explored and implemented a pilot system of crop rotation and fallow in some areas.

In February 2018, the former Ministry of Agriculture held a press conference on the pilot project of the cultivated land rotation and fallow system. The person in charge of the planting industry management department introduced at the meeting: "The crop rotation mainly implements the rotation of corn and soybeans, and exerts the role of soybean root nodules in nitrogen fixation and soil cultivation. , to realize the combination of planting and raising land, and sustainable agricultural development. Fallow is to reduce the use of cultivated land water resources, so that the cultivated land can be recuperated, and at the same time be treated to ensure that the cultivated land can be used when it is urgently needed, and the grain can be produced.”

  In September 2016, Yanshan County was designated by Yunnan Province as a pilot county for arable land fallow, with the first batch of 10,000 mu of fallow.

"Green manure crops such as sweet potato are planted in the fallow land, without watering, fertilizing, or spraying pesticides. When they grow up, they will be plowed directly into the field to improve the soil structure." said Shen Dechao, director of the Soil and Fertilizer Workstation of Yanshan County.

  "In the past, everyone didn't recognize the replacement of crops, but only believed that the selling price of soybeans was high." Wang Yanju, director of the Sisifang Agricultural Products Planting Professional Cooperative in Hailun City, Heilongjiang Province, said that soybeans in Helen are expensive, and farmers chase after the price, planting soybeans crop by crop , The long-term monoculture leads to more and more chemical fertilizers, the poorer the soil, and the more frequent diseases, "The black soil has become a 'three-run field' that runs away from water, soil and fertilizer."

  In 2017, part of the cultivated land in Zhongfu Village where Wang Yanju lives was included in the crop rotation pilot.

What are the benefits of crop rotation?

In the autumn of that year, under the organization of the Agricultural Technology Promotion Center of Hailun City, Wang Yanju visited the agricultural demonstration park in the city.

Wang Yanju pushed aside the black soil and looked up and down, only to see that the soybean root system in the crop replacement area was more developed and the seeds were fuller.

Listening to the expert's technical explanation, he decided to take out 800 mu of land and try to rotate corn in the coming year.

  One year of corn, one year of soybeans, and two years later, seeing the gratifying growth of soybeans in Wang Yanju's field after changing stubble, many villagers came to "learn."

"In the past five years of crop rotation, the yield per mu of soybeans and corn has increased by 20%, but the use of chemical fertilizers has decreased by 20%. The common soybean sclerotinia and purple spot diseases in the past have also decreased." Pressing the calculator, I opened the agricultural situation File, Wang Yanju couldn't hide her joy.

In 2022, the crop rotation area of ​​Zhongfu Village will reach 2,400 mu, a year-on-year increase of 20%, and the total grain output will increase by 24% year-on-year.

  "Through comprehensive measures such as crop rotation fallow, straw returning, deep plowing and deep loosening, the average thickness of the cultivated land in the province's crop rotation fallow pilot areas has increased by 22.8%, reaching 28.4 cm. Such soil can better preserve moisture and fertilizer." Heilongjiang Province Guo Jiayong, deputy director of the planting management department of the Department of Agriculture and Rural Affairs, said.

  According to Zhang Honglei, general manager of the 93rd branch of Beidahuang Land Reclamation Group Co., Ltd., according to regional advantages and crop layout, Beidahuang Group mainly uses corn and soybean rotations, supplemented by rotations of miscellaneous grains, miscellaneous beans, forage grass, and oil crops. Up to 80% or more.

  How to determine the rotation crops for each year?

Each farm not only formulates tasks in response to government guidance and market needs, but also scientifically decomposes and adjusts tasks based on the agricultural files of each plot.

"We fully consider the planting history of the plots, and try our best to implement inter-family and genus rotations of legumes, corn, sorghum and other gramineous crops." Zhang Honglei said.

  Open the No. 1-4-2 field files stored on the computer of the Jiusan Branch Heshan Farm, and every agricultural activity in this field from spring sowing, summer management to autumn harvest in recent years is clear at a glance.

"What was planted in which year, what pesticide was sprayed when, and the deep plowing or harrowing were all recorded in the book." He Yulong, a grower in the first management area of ​​Heshan Farm, introduced that what is suitable for planting on this land in the coming year, these records It is all based on scientific evidence, "For example, some fertilizers used in the previous corn field are beneficial to the soybean production in the next year, so we will tend to rotate soybeans in this field."

  Wei Qing told reporters that the land under his feet used to be planted with one season of rice and one season of wheat each year. The two grass crops were planted together, and the soil fertility burden was heavy. Every mu of rice had to be fertilized with 100 jin of fertilizer; The yield is low, and it is easy to encounter high temperature and rainfall during the harvest period, which induces scab and affects the quality.

  In 2016, Jiangsu launched a pilot project of the provincial-level crop rotation and fallow system. In areas with low crop production efficiency and obvious ecological degradation in autumn and winter, methods such as crop rotation, winter plowing and sun-drying, and fallow and fertilization were implemented.

In the same year, Wei Qing changed all the 290 mu of land he transferred to planting rice in one season and green manure in the other, and received a subsidy of 200 yuan per mu.

  In 2018, Jiangsu Province was identified as a pilot province for the national cultivated land rotation and fallow system. Nanjing City further optimized the crop rotation mode, changing the rice-fertilizer rotation to rice-oil rotation, and shifting from mainly growing land to combining land-raising: rape leaves and flowers can fertilize the field , rapeseed can be pressed for oil.

In 2020, Wei Qing planted dual-purpose oilseed rape under the guidance of the agricultural technology department.

  "The amount of fertilization has been reduced, and the quality of rice has improved." Wei Qing introduced that the protein content of rice is more suitable between 8% and 10%, and the higher the content, the worse the taste. The average amount of fertilizer applied has dropped from 100 catties in the past to the current 60 catties, the protein content per 100 grams of rice has dropped from 11 grams to about 8.2 grams, and the price of rice has risen from 3.5 yuan per catty to more than 8 yuan. The net income per mu is nearly 3,000 yuan."

  Taking the rice oil tanker as an opportunity, Nanjing continues to expand the planting area of ​​winter rapeseed, which will reach about 300,000 mu in 2020, achieving the first restorative growth of winter rapeseed planting area in 10 years.

Since 2016, financial funds at all levels in Nanjing have invested nearly 300 million yuan to complete the fallow area of ​​more than 1.37 million mu of cultivated land, and the organic matter content of cultivated land in the implementation area has increased by about 1% on average.

  In February 2018, the former Ministry of Agriculture held a press conference on the pilot project of the crop rotation and fallow system. The relevant person in charge introduced at the meeting that the technical model of the crop rotation and fallow pilot project is mature and applicable, and the ecological effect has initially appeared, which is mainly reflected in two aspects: One is the coordination of production and ecology.

The "three-three crop rotation" model has been established in cool and cool areas, the "damage control and soil cultivation" model has been established in heavy metal polluted areas and areas with serious ecological degradation, and the "one-season rain-fed and one-season fallow" model has been established in groundwater funnel areas; The area is consistent with the suitable species.

Choose legumes, solanaceae, grasses and other crops with complementary nutrient utilization and different occurrence patterns of diseases and insect pests to improve the efficiency of light, temperature and water use and reduce the loss of diseases and insect pests.

After soybean rotation in the mountainous areas of eastern Jilin, the use of chemical fertilizers has been reduced by more than 30%, and the use of pesticides has been reduced by about 50%.

They calculated both income accounts and ecological accounts: Hebei is located in the largest groundwater funnel area in the country, and the per capita water resources are far lower than National average, winter wheat cultivation needs groundwater pumping for irrigation.

Changing wheat and corn from twice a year to early-sowed corn once a year, realizing one season (wheat) fallow and one season (corn) planting, can reduce water consumption by 150 cubic meters per mu.

  "Land is the fundamental guarantee for the survival of farmers. To make farmers willing to carry out crop rotation and fallow, it is necessary to ensure that their income will not decrease." In June 2016, the comrades in charge of the former Ministry of Agriculture interpreted the "Pilot Plan for Exploring and Implementing the Crop Rotation and Fallow System" Shi introduced that the central finance will allocate the subsidy funds to the provinces, and the provinces will make overall arrangements according to the pilot tasks, and adopt the method of directly distributing cash or in-kind subsidies based on local conditions, and implement them to counties and townships, and cash them out to farmers.

  According to the subsidy standards determined in the "Pilot Plan for Exploring and Implementing the Crop Rotation and Fallow System", the pilot crop rotation subsidy is 150 yuan per mu per year, the seasonal fallow pilot in the groundwater funnel area of ​​Hebei is subsidized 500 yuan per mu per year, and the two-season crop areas in Guizhou and Yunnan are fallow all year round The pilot subsidy is 1,000 yuan per mu per year... Yue Yunbo, director of the Agriculture and Rural Bureau of Yongqing County, said that the funds required for the fallow subsidy are combined with the central financial subsidy funds for comprehensive management of groundwater overexploitation.

Follow the procedure of subsidy after implementation, and cash out after publicity. After passing the acceptance check, cash out to the cooperatives or farmers who implement seasonal fallow through "one discount" or "all-in-one card".

  According to the information published on the website of the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s, since the pilot implementation of the crop rotation and fallow system for more than six years, the central government has continued to increase support, and the implementation scale of crop rotation and fallow has increased year by year.

The implementation area will increase from 6.16 million mu in 2016 to 69.26 million mu in 2022, the subsidy funds will increase from 1.436 billion yuan to 11.145 billion yuan, and the number of implementation provinces will increase from 9 to 24.
